(COLUMBIA, MO) ~ Columbia Parks and Recreation is gearing up for their annual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. Candlelight Walk and Memorial Celebration, set to take place on Monday, Jan. 20. The event will begin at 6:30 p.m. at the Armory Sports Center, located at 701 E. Ash St. Attendees are asked to gather in the basement of the facility, with the lower level entrance accessible from the back of the building.

From there, participants will embark on a candlelit walk to St. Luke United Methodist Church, located at 204 E. Ash St., where the memorial celebration will commence at 7 p.m. This event serves as a time for individuals to come together and honor the life and legacy of Dr. King.
